The Last of Us Part II Remastered on PC received DLSS 4 and Multi Frame Generation in patch 1.4

Studios Nixxes and Naughty Dog Release Update 1.4 for PC version The Last of Us Part II Remastered, focusing on integration of next-generation graphic technologies and eliminating critical technical problems. The main innovation was DLSS 4 with support Multi Frame Generation, which is now available for GeForce RTX 50 series graphics cards.

The new version of DLSS is based on neural network model of the Transformer type, providing a cleaner image, better anti-aliasing and reduced visual artifacts. Players can manually choose between the new model and classic mode Legacy in the screen settings. Also appeared Max Generated Frames option, which allows flexible control over the intensity of frame generation on RTX 50 - up to 4 additional frames for each rendered one.

There are also improvements for users of other graphics cards. AMD owners have received Fixes for FSR technology, which fixes frame generation issues. On systems with Intel graphics cards, a updated version XeSS 2.0.1, which improves the quality of upscaling. These changes make the patch relevant for a wide audience, and not just RTX owners.

In addition to graphics, patch 1.4 fixes dozens of bugs: Fixed bugs with hair, snow and depth of field, bugs with the DualSense controller via Bluetooth, as well as issues with textures, interface and cinematics in ultra-wide modes. Localization has been updated, accessibility has been improved and stability during long sessions has been increased. The developers promise to continue support and release additional improvements in the coming updates.
